Events: From Dubai with Love

When you love someone, the feeling is Always there whether the loved one is here, there or anywhere. This is primarily true with my only daughter Jingle who went out of her way to get permission from her Boss to spend some quality time with me when I was on a stopover at Dubai International Airport from Amman, Jordan to Manila. Truth is, Jingle is the daughter of my younger brother Loy who succumbed to throat cancer at the age of 38. Since then, Jingle has always looked up to me as her Dad and I have considered her as my only daughter. As a matter of fact, she is in my Will with my only sister Elizabeth in Orange County, California USA, who I know really cares for me.


NDB's Albert Rile with his only daughter Jingle at Dubai International Airport.*

Lately, when Jingle came home to attend the graduation of her nephew JM, I had to drag myself out of bed so very early in the morning to be at Silay- Bacolod International Airport at 5:30AM for her 5:50AM- arrival. She looked exhausted and famished just as I did when I was in Dubai, so I took her to Bobs for a big breakfast. She mentioned that she must have looked like me when she met me at their duty free shop where she works as a Supervisor. However, all that feeling of starvation and exhaustion were gone once we met and we were both happy together!

I am aware that I had offended my only daughter a few times before as she too, had her shortcomings but we were- still are- always quick to forgive and forget. Why, love is not only sacrifice, it also tantamount to overlooking one’s fault.

A couple of days after her arrival, her favourite Maninay/ Tita Tata Seva Cu treated both of us to a welcome home lunch at Max’s in SM. She from Dubai and me from that memorable pilgrimage from the Holy Land. We had a wonderful time recalling those good old days, just bonding. Then, her Maninay went shopping with her and bought her those pretty and expensive blouses and pants while I just looked around, sort of window shopping. When we reached the car (after she thanked and kiss her god mother so long), she confessed that for the first time in her life, she felt the love a mother. Being our god daughter, my best friend (who is like my sister) Tata considers her as her daughter too as she has two well behaved sons by her beloved husband Ramon Cu.

Day before her departure back to Dubai (she was only given a two- week vacation), I treated her and her biological mother, my brother’s wife Nene Guanzon Rile to lunch at Pendy’s with her Maninay/ Tita Tata. I gave Tata a copy of our picture at Dubai Airport for her two sons to see their beautiful big sister.

While it is true that my only daughter got to spend some time with immediate members of her family, we got to enjoy some quality time here and Dubai. It’s all because of our father- daughter relationship and our emails always end with “Love and Kisses,” like what my late Tatay and I had each time we wrote each other while I was finishing college at good old University of San Carlos in Cebu and he was with the family in Manila. There is ALWAYS love between us in Dubai, Bacolod or the US or anywhere!
